If the car was made before 1 January 1992 and the maker hasn't specified an optimum towing ability, utilize these towing capabilities as an overview:1.5 times the unloaded mass of the vehicleif the trailer is fitted with appropriate brakesa optimum of 750kgif the trailer isn't fitted with brakes.


You may tow only 1 trailer (campers, box or boat) at once. People need to not ride in trailers/caravans. A removable tow coupling can be gotten rid of when not in use. This will certainly prevent blocking the number plate and reduce the threat to people strolling behind the lorry. When hauling a trailer (consisting of caravans), bear in mind to: enable the extra size and width of the trailer when going into trafficallow for its propensity to 'cut in' on edges and curvesaccelerate, brake and guide efficiently and gently to prevent swayingallow for the impacts of cross-winds, passing website traffic and uneven road surfacesleave a much longer quiting distance between you and the automobile ahead; enhance the space for longer, much heavier trailers and permit much more range in poor driving conditionsuse a reduced equipment in both hand-operated and automatic vehicles when taking a trip downhill to make your automobile much easier to regulate and lower the stress on your brakesallow more time and distance to overtake and prevent 'removing' the automobile you are surpassing when going back to the left lanefit a reversing cam or obtain somebody to enjoy the rear of the trailer when you reversereversing is challenging and takes practicenot hold up trafficpull off the road where it is safe to do so, and where it will not develop an accumulation of website traffic unable to overtakebe conscious that your car and trailer will have a tendency to sway when a heavy vehicle overtakes you.
